What neckline is best for my body shape?

Scoop Neck

 

Body Type: The scoop neck flatters most body shapes, especially curvy figures and those with broader shoulders. It’s also great for anyone wanting to highlight their collarbones and bust. 

Benefits: This neckline creates a soft, feminine silhouette while elongating the neck and upper chest. 

Pair it With:

– Delicate necklaces or chokers to enhance the neckline. 

– Balanced earrings such as studs or small hoops. 

– Both flowy and fitted tops, making it suitable for any occasion from day to night.

Boat Neck

Body Type: This neckline works well for people with narrow shoulders and longer necks. It adds grace by broadening the appearance of the shoulders, making it a lovely option for balancing pear-shaped figures. 

Benefits: The boat neck draws attention to the shoulders and enhances your posture, contributing to a polished and sophisticated look. 

Pair it With:

– Statement earrings, while skipping necklaces to keep the focus on the neckline. 

– Structured garments like blazers for a professional touch.

V-Neck

Body Type: The V-neck is particularly suited for: 

– Short necks (it creates an elongating effect). 

– Broad shoulders (it softens and balances proportions). 

– Petite frames (it lengthens the torso). 

– Hourglass figures (it emphasizes curves while drawing attention downward). 

Benefits: This neckline is versatile and generally flattering, providing a longer and slimmer appearance. 

Pair it with: 

– Long necklaces or pendants that mimic the V shape. 

– Layered cardigans or blazers for work attire. 

– High-waisted jeans or skirts for a chic casual look.

 

Crew Neck

Body Type: The crew neck works best for those with: 

– Longer necks (it adds balance). 

– Smaller busts (it enhances and offers fullness). 

– Narrow shoulders (it widens the upper frame for better proportions). 

Benefits: This neckline offers a clean, modest style, perfect for layering or creating a laid-back vibe. 

Pair it with:

– Statement necklaces or scarves to elevate the neckline. 

– Blazers or cardigans for a polished outfit. 

– Skinny jeans or tailored pants for a smart casual appearance.

 

Square Neck

Body Type: This neckline flatters nearly all shapes, particularly: 

– Defined shoulders (it showcases structure). 

– Curvier figures (it emphasizes the neckline). 

– Those with longer torsos (it balances proportions). 

Benefits: The square neck makes a bold statement while providing a sophisticated look. 

Pair it with:

– Bold necklaces that match the neckline’s shape. 

– High-waisted trousers or skirts for a sleek silhouette. 

– Layering pieces like jackets or cardigans to add depth. 

 

In conclusion, it’s important to remember that these suggestions serve as guidelines rather than strict rules. Factors such as fabric choice, individual style, and size all play a significant role in achieving the perfect fit and look. The best approach to discovering what works for you is to experiment with different cuts and styles. Embrace the process and find what truly complements your unique aesthetic!
